The form titled 'Notice of Satisfaction' is crucial for establishing that all conditions outlined in the Escrow Agreement have been fulfilled, except for specific liens that will be resolved upon payment. In Nassau, understanding the difference between 'satisfaction' and 'satisfactory' is important, as 'satisfaction' implies complete fulfillment of obligations, while 'satisfactory' refers to meeting expectations without full completion. The form includes sections for acknowledging the receipt of evidence regarding these conditions and authorizing the Escrow Agent to disburse funds accordingly. Satisfying: It means fulfilling a need or desire in a way that brings contentment or great pleasure. Satisficing: This is a term that combines "satisfy" and "suffice." It refers to accepting an option that meets the minimum criteria for acceptability, rather than seeking the best possible outcome.

To satisfy is to meet to the full one's wants, expectations, etc.: to satisfy a desire to travel. To content is to give enough to keep one from being disposed to find fault or complain: to content oneself with a moderate meal.

If someone or something satisfies you, they give you enough of what you want or need to make you pleased or contented. To satisfy someone that something is true or has been done properly means to convince them by giving them more information or by showing them what has been done.

If something's satisfactory it's okay — acceptable, but maybe not great. When you take a course pass/fail, your grade will be satisfactory if you meet all the requirements and do a reasonable job, or unsatisfactory if you don't. Try not to confuse satisfactory and satisfying.

"Satisfactory" means that something is adequate, or acceptable. Whereas "satisfying" means that something meets your needs or requirements and has positive associations.

"Satisfying" is an adjective describing something that fulfills a need or provides contentment in an action or experience. "Satisfied" is the past participle of the verb "satisfy" and signifies the feeling of contentment or fulfillment in a person after their desires have been met.
